Output 823067acab764ae349368c21c3435f1986af107b6beecb7780261346709da7d5:1

value
54980000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03ca63ea12d85971f487a6e2b6dfd9fc0e54274e OP_EQUALVERIFY OP_CHECKSIG
address
1M3UuAad1mHZeJjSDZ7LVsPaeLXJuMFWX
transaction
823067acab764ae349368c21c3435f1986af107b6beecb7780261346709da7d5
spent
true